Interview Process Overview
The interview process for the Financial Analyst position at Compass typically consists of multiple stages designed to evaluate your fit for the role and the company. Candidates can expect an initial screening with HR, followed by interviews with hiring managers and team members. The process may include a take-home case study and a panel presentation, allowing you to demonstrate your analytical abilities and communication skills.
Communication during the process can vary, with some candidates noting delays in feedback or follow-up. This can be disheartening, but it is essential to maintain professionalism and patience. Compass seeks candidates who not only possess the necessary skills but also demonstrate resilience and adaptability in their approach.

Deep Dive into Evaluation Areas
In your interviews, you will be evaluated on several key areas essential for success as a Financial Analyst at Compass.
Financial Acumen
This area focuses on your understanding of financial principles and analytical skills. Interviewers will assess your ability to interpret financial statements and apply financial modeling techniques. Strong performance includes demonstrating proficiency with Excel and relevant financial software.
- Financial modeling – Ability to create and interpret complex financial models.
- Data analysis – Experience analyzing large datasets for insights.
- Market analysis – Understanding of real estate market trends and dynamics.
Communication Skills
Effectively conveying your ideas is crucial in this role. Interviewers will evaluate how clearly you express your thoughts, particularly when discussing complex financial topics. Strong candidates will demonstrate clarity, confidence, and the ability to tailor their communication to different audiences.
- Presentation skills – Ability to present data-driven insights compellingly.
- Stakeholder engagement – Experience working with various teams and stakeholders.
Adaptability and Resilience
Given the dynamic nature of the real estate market, adaptability is essential. Interviewers will look for examples of how you have navigated challenges and adjusted your approach in response to changing conditions.
- Crisis management – Experience in handling unexpected challenges effectively.
- Learning agility – Willingness to learn and adapt to new tools and methodologies.
